Further reading, links and resources
- General
Salzberg (2019) Next-generation genome annotation: we still struggle to get it right. Genome Biol 20:92. (pmid: 31097009) |
Ejigu & Jung (2020) Review on the Computational Genome Annotation of Sequences Obtained by Next-Generation Sequencing. Biology (Basel) 9:. (pmid: 32962098) |
- Encode
Davis et al. (2018) The Encyclopedia of DNA elements (ENCODE): data portal update. Nucleic Acids Res 46:D794-D801. (pmid: 29126249) |
ENCODE Project Consortium (2011) A user's guide to the encyclopedia of DNA elements (ENCODE). PLoS Biol 9:e1001046. (pmid: 21526222) |
- Annotation example papers
Lok et al. (2017) De Novo Genome and Transcriptome Assembly of the Canadian Beaver (Castor canadensis). G3 (Bethesda) 7:755-773. (pmid: 28087693) |
Seo et al. (2016) De novo assembly and phasing of a Korean human genome. Nature 538:243-247. (pmid: 27706134) |
Amemiya et al. (2013) The African coelacanth genome provides insights into tetrapod evolution. Nature 496:311-6. (pmid: 23598338) |
- Specific topics
- Copy Number Variation
Zarrei et al. (2015) A copy number variation map of the human genome. Nat Rev Genet 16:172-83. (pmid: 25645873) - miRNA
Bracken et al. (2016) A network-biology perspective of microRNA function and dysfunction in cancer. Nat Rev Genet 17:719-732. (pmid: 27795564) - Epigenomics
Stricker et al. (2017) From profiles to function in epigenomics. Nat Rev Genet 18:51-66. (pmid: 27867193) Notes
